How to Build Direct Marketing Campaigns That Don’t Waste Leads
- Anne Thompson

- Aug 21
- 3 min read
Turning raw customer insights into tested campaigns that convert and scale.
Just launched your new business and need resources to ace direct marketing at lower costs with higher ROI?
Check out Salesfully’s course, Mastering Sales Fundamentals for Long-Term Success, designed to help you attract new customers efficiently and affordably.
The Problem with Data Hoarding
Many sales and marketing teams pride themselves on having massive databases of leads but struggle to turn that information into actionable campaigns. As Harvard Business School’s Sunil Gupta once wrote, “Data by itself is useless.
Its power comes from the insights we draw and the actions we take.” Collecting thousands of contacts is only the beginning; without segmentation, structured campaigns, and continuous testing, most leads are wasted.
Recent research from Statista shows that 53% of marketers say their biggest challenge with data-driven marketing is applying insights to strategy. This gap between knowledge and execution is where most campaigns fall short.
Step One Segmentation as a Blueprint
Segmentation is not just about slicing your database—it is about aligning the message with the recipient’s world. For B2B marketing, segmentation often includes firmographics: industry, company size, and decision-maker role. For B2C campaigns, it is often behavioral: purchase history, location, and digital triggers like cart abandonment or email clicks.
A 2024 McKinsey study found that companies excelling in personalization through segmentation generated 40% more revenue than those with a one-size-fits-all approach.

Step Two Campaign Testing Framework
Once the segmentation blueprint is in place, campaigns must be stress-tested. A well-structured A/B testing model allows marketers to validate which messages resonate, which channels carry weight, and which cadences maintain attention without fatigue.
Message Testing: Comparing subject lines, CTAs, or offers
Channel Layering: Email supported by direct mail or SMS reminders
Cadence Mapping: Weekly nudges vs. monthly check-ins
Companies like HubSpot consistently emphasize that A/B testing is not a “nice-to-have”—it is the only way to ensure that assumptions don’t eat budget.
Step Three Tracking ROI with Precision
Without measurement, even the best campaigns risk being “activity for activity’s sake.” A tracking sheet template—often as simple as a shared Google Sheet or CRM dashboard—should log cost-per-lead, cost-per-conversion, and lifetime value (LTV).
According to Gartner, 65% of CMOs struggle to demonstrate ROI to their CEOs. A structured ROI tracker not only guides optimization but also builds internal credibility for continued budget allocation.

A Practical Framework
When data segmentation (who), testing (how), and ROI tracking (outcomes) are combined, marketing transforms from guesswork to system. Campaigns stop being reactive and start being designed experiments that compound over time.
For a deeper breakdown of data-driven direct marketing strategies in practice, this video from Marketing 360 provides a practical walkthrough of turning insights into campaigns.
Conclusion
Direct marketing succeeds not through the sheer volume of leads but through structured action applied to those leads. Businesses that build systems for segmentation, testing, and measurement not only avoid waste but also accelerate growth.
The companies that survive the next decade will not be the ones with the most data, but the ones who can translate data into deliberate, repeatable campaigns.
Just launched your new business and need resources to ace direct marketing at lower costs with higher ROI?
Check out Salesfully’s course, Mastering Sales Fundamentals for Long-Term Success, designed to help you attract new customers efficiently and affordably.
Don't stop there! Create your free Salesfully account today and gain instant access to premium sales data and essential resources to fuel your startup journey.
.png)















Comments